The streetlights not working (which is all of them!) on The Undercliffe, Sandgate, have been reported to Kent Highways by Folkestone West County Councillor Tim Prater. The lights went out on 4th February and reported soon after. Kent Highways sent an engineer to the road on Tuesday 8th February and diagnosed a cable fault.
